注册机的编写文件通常涉及到编写一个程序,该程序用于生成特定的注册码或序列号,这些注册码或序列号可以用于激活软件或验证用户身份。以下是一个简单的注册机文件编写的基本步骤。
具体的编程语言和工具可能会因项目需求和个人偏好而异,这里以Python语言为例进行说明。
1、确定需求:首先明确注册机的功能需求,例如生成什么样的注册码(数字、字母、混合等),注册码的长度,是否需要包含时间戳、硬件信息等。

2、选择编程语言和工具:根据项目需求选择合适的编程语言和工具,如Python、Java等。
3、创建项目文件:在选定的编程环境中创建一个新的项目文件,例如命名为register_machine.py。
4、编写代码:根据需求编写注册机的代码,以下是一个简单的Python示例代码,用于生成包含字母和数字的随机注册码:
import random
import string
import datetime
def generate_registration_code(length):
# 生成随机字母和数字的组合
characters = string.ascii_letters + string.digits
registration_code = ’’.join(random.choice(characters) for _ in range(length))
return registration_code
def add_timestamp(registration_code):
# 添加时间戳信息到注册码中
timestamp = datetime.datetime.now().strftime(’%Y%m%d%H%M%S’)
return registration_code + timestamp
def main():
# 设置注册码长度
code_length = 10 # 可以根据需要调整长度
# 生成注册码并添加时间戳信息
registration_code = add_timestamp(generate_registration_code(code_length))
print("生成的注册码为:", registration_code)
if __name__ == "__main__":
main()这段代码首先定义了两个函数,一个用于生成随机注册码,另一个用于在注册码中添加时间戳信息,然后在main()函数中调用这两个函数生成注册码并打印出来,你可以根据需要修改代码来满足你的具体需求。
5、运行和测试:保存文件后,运行程序并测试注册机的功能,确保生成的注册码符合预期要求。
6、打包和分发(如果需要):如果你需要将注册机分发给其他用户,你可能需要将其打包为一个可执行文件或安装程序,具体的打包和分发方式取决于你使用的编程语言和工具。
只是一个简单的示例,实际的注册机可能会更复杂,涉及更多的功能和安全性考虑,在开发注册机时,请确保遵守相关法律法规和用户隐私保护原则。







